David Alonso
David Alonso Gómez (born 25 April 2006) is a Grand Prix motorcycle racer who currently competes for the CFMoto Aspar Racing Team in the Moto2 World Championship. Colombian by maternal descent and Spanish by paternal descent, he represents Colombia internationally. Born in Spain, he also has Spanish citizenship. He won the European Talent Cup in 2020 and the Red Bull MotoGP Rookies Cup in 2021. He won the 2024 season of Moto3.
Alonso won the European Talent Cup in 2020. The following year, he won the 2021 Red Bull MotoGP Rookies Cup. He clinched that championship when he finished third in the first race of the Aragón round on 11 September.
Alonso was signed by the Gas Gas Aspar Team and made his Moto3 debut at the 2021 Emilia Romagna Grand Prix as a replacement for Sergio García who was injured in the previous round. The following season, he made his second start at the Portuguese round as a wildcard rider. He made his full season debut in the 2023 Moto3 World Championship. In 2024, he was crowned as the new champion in the Japanese Grand Prix.
Alonso will move up to Moto2 with the CFMOTO Aspar Team for the 2025 Moto2 season, partnering Daniel Holgado. He became the first rider to complete the Aspar Team's training ladder, from the Spanish Championship to the Moto2 category.
